Associate Consultant

About the Firm

Social Strategy Associates LLC is an inspired consultancy, passionate about the power of philanthropy and business to positively impact our world's most pressing social and environmental issues. We work with leading foundations, corporations, and nonprofits to design, implement, and manage strategic philanthropy and social responsibility programs. As a distributed team with roots in New York City, we serve clients across the country.

We are advisors, facilitators and strategists with the goal of expanding our clients’ capacity to deliver great philanthropy. Our approach is highly collaborative, innovative and results-driven. You can learn more about our service offerings in our firm’s capabilities deck.

Current client projects focus on a diverse array of issue areas, including social innovation, early childhood development, equitable economic recovery, and labor and worker rights.

Across all our work, we prioritize equity and diversity of backgrounds, thought, and experiences. We strive to support organizations that work not just for but with impacted communities and center their voices and leadership. 

 

About this Role

We are excited to expand our small but mighty team by bringing on a new full-time teammate. The Associate Consultant will support client accounts by producing detailed deliverables, preparing for and contributing to client meetings, conducting research and analysis, responding to client communications, and all other facets of efficiently and effectively shepherding social impact work forward and delighting clients while doing so. The ideal candidate will be able to seamlessly toggle between 30,000-foot strategy and in-the-weeds details, and between accounts. 

The Associate Consultant should be passionate about work that centers underserved and overlooked communities and have experience bringing a justice lens to the work. He/she/they will have the innate drive to run the ball down the field as far as one can, but the emotional maturity to know when it makes sense to check in internally with a teammate. We pride ourselves on having a collaborative and all-hands-on-deck work culture – that is, from developing high-level strategy to printing out name tags the morning of a public event, all team members work together to get the job done.

The position was previously based out of a beautiful client office in the Flatiron neighborhood of New York City. However, over these last two years our team has transitioned to primarily remote work. Core U.S.-based team members are now located in New York City, Palm Springs, CA and Bozeman, MT. Given our current comfort with remote work, we are excited to hear from qualified applicants across the U.S. with willingness to travel; we still value the opportunity to come together to co-work on location.

Responsibilities include:

    Actively support project leads in the day-to-day of managing client accounts, which includes preparing detailed agendas, quickly and accurately responding to client requests, taking detailed notes during client meetings, scheduling meetings with internal and external parties, and other operational and administrative tasks. Prepare and present client deliverables (e.g., PowerPoint presentations, research reports, Excel workbooks), inclusive of the research, analysis, and administrative tasks that contribute to these deliverables. Share responsibility for account budgets and timelines. Build the capacity of a young firm, from editing proposals to enhancing internal processes to representing the firm at external functions. Actively engage in internal brainstorms and external meetings to provide input on ongoing projects.

 

A qualified applicant will:

    BA or BS degree in a related field. Have two years of management consulting, program management, or similar experience in a detail-oriented, professional setting. Possess advanced skills in PowerPoint, Excel, and Word; knowledge of Google Workspace, Foundant, SurveyMonkey, Doodle, WordPress and Constant Contact is also desirable. Demonstrate excellent communication skills, both verbal and written, as well as possess outstanding interpersonal skills. To be clear, strong writing skills are absolutely critical. Demonstrate superior analytical and organizational skills, including attention to detail and a commitment to rigor. Demonstrate strong critical thinking skills in answering research questions using existing frameworks or by creating new ones. Be a smart generalist and self starter possessing high levels of independence and intrinsic motivation. Be a positive individual who maintains composure under pressure and when receiving direct feedback from colleagues and clients. Be comfortable working in a constantly evolving small business environment. Be entrepreneurial. Have a willingness to travel; travel requirements vary by client. Have experience working in, or substantial interest in, the social impact space. Current SSA accounts focus on a diverse range of social impact topics, including social and environmental innovation, early childhood development, equitable economic recovery, and labor and worker rights.

 

The starting salary range for this position is $60,000 - $65,000 per year, commensurate with experience. Numerous benefits are provided, including a $450 per month health expense reimbursement through a QSEHRA plan, a company-issued laptop, opportunities for in-person onboarding and client travel, immediate exposure to philanthropic and nonprofit leaders, and bespoke professional development opportunities. The firm offers 13 paid holidays and 15 additional days of paid time off.
